WebDec 6, 2016 · BE-3 (Blue Engine-3) is the first combustion tap-off cycle engine ever to have flown on a rocket. It was developed by Blue Originand first announced in 2013. The … WebThe BE-3 (Blue Engine 3) is a LH2/LOX rocket engine developed by Blue Origin. The engine began development in the early 2010s, ... the BE-3PM, uses a pump-fed engine design, with a combustion tap-off cycle to take a small amount of combustion gases from the main combustion chamber in order to power the engine turbopumps. WebOct 22, 2024 · The expander cycle is a power cycle of a bipropellant rocket engine. In this cycle, the fuel is used to cool the engine's combustion chamber, picking up heat and changing phase. The cycle takes a small portion of hot exhaust gas from the rocket engine's combustion chamber and routes it through turbopump turbines to pump fuel before being exhausted (similar to the gas-generator cycle). Since fuel is exhausted, the tap-off cycle is considered an open-cycle engine. The cycle is c… mattel handheld footballgame worth
